Tyler Raad is an active performer and musician in the Fargo area. He is a three-time NATS finalist in South Dakota, winning First place in 2008 and 2009, and a semi-finalist in Minnesota in 2011. He has performed on several professional stages including the Black Hills Players where he was featured in shows like Godspell (Jesus), Oklahoma (Curly), and Mousetrap (Sgt. Trotter); the Black Hills Playhouse in their production of Return to the Forbidden Planet (Cookie); and most recently at the Fargo-Moorhead Opera in La Cenerentola (chorus). He has also been featured on collegiate and regional stages in productions of Dido and Aeneas (Aeneas) and Amahl and the Night Visitors (Kaspar). Tyler was given scholarship to the Johanna Meier Institute for the summers of 2008 and 2009 where he performed in the roles of Frederic (Pirates of Penzance) and Orlofsky (Die Fledermaus). There he received coaching from Johanna Meier, Dr. John Stuart, and Bruce Donell. He has also been their production assistant for the last two years and has been offered stage manager for summer 2012. He studied voice in the studio of Dr. Nancy Roberts and obtained his bachelors in both music and theatre performance in May of 2011 from Black Hills State University. Tyler was given an assistantship to North Dakota State University in August of 2011 where he is currently studying voice in the studio of Dr. Robert Jones and is pursuing a masters degree in vocal performance. He will graduate spring of 2013. In addition to performing, Tyler enjoys all aspects of the theatre and has experience in light design, scenic design/construction, and audio engineering. He loves to direct and choreograph and has experience in both. Above all else, he loves to teach private voice and aspires to expand his studio.
